Transaction 4bfd2562606947ce32de8edff1c8fc445cccdd6b225a0f0e667e68d9038ecc3e
1 Input
1 Output
-
4bfd2562606947ce32de8edff1c8fc445cccdd6b225a0f0e667e68d9038ecc3e:0
- value
- 3914469
- script pubkey
- OP_0 OP_PUSHBYTES_20 428fa1da5aa0b126318131092fdc8f47d18a7a70
- address
- bc1qg286rkj65zcjvvvpxyyjlhy0glgc57nsdjulwt